Description
Currently, the most informative method for examining patients is computed tomography(CT scan). This method allows the doctor to make a complete picture of the structure and density of bone tissue and features of the anatomy of the jaws. During the examination, the doctor receives accurate data about the distance between the anatomical formations (maxillary sinus, mandibular canal, etc.).
However, a full diagnosis is not a guarantee of successful treatment. It is equally important to use high-precision and modern planning methods.

How does it work
The system includes the Implantmed3D (Germany) program for the processing of computer tomography of the jaws and the Schick X1 device (Germany) for transferring data from the computer and installing it on a template of titanium tubes.The technique of dental implantation using navigation technology involves virtual planning, which will allow the implants to be installed as precisely as possible.
According to these data, virtual planning of quantity, type of implants, their position, size and type of prosthodontic construction is carried out.
After coordination of the compiled virtual plan with the doctor and patient, a navigation model is made with the help of special equipment.
This model fully corresponds to the operation area and allows to install the implant in it’s right position. So by this system we can avoid surgical and prosthodontic errors and prevent complications. Also, with the use of navigation technology, it is possible to carry out operations with a flapless technique (without incisions and sutures) and make the prosthodontic constructions before the surgery.
